Neuromuscular Electrical Stimulation Via the Peroneal Nerve Reduces Muscle Soreness Following Intermittent Exercise

Numerous techniques are reported to enhance recovery following intense exercise, however there is equivocal support for such claims. A novel technique of neuromuscular electrical stimulation (NMES) via the peroneal nerve has been shown to augment limb blood flow which could enhance recovery following exercise. The present study examined the effects of NMES, compared to graduated compression socks on muscle soreness, strength, and markers of muscle damage and inflammation following intense intermittent exercise.
